It is no secret that many people find it difficult to manage your iPhone through iTunes. Apple's multimedia application is a great application that, once we get to it, is very versatile and simple, but not all of us think the same. That is why many of you look for alternatives such as iFunbox or iMaging, but they have stopped working with the arrival of iOS 8.3. If you want to manage your videos and songs without using iTunes, without jailbreak, quickly and easily, your alternative is called WALTR.
WALTR is an application that exists for the sole reason of eliminating complications when transferring multimedia files (audio and video) from a computer to your iPhone / iPod or iPad. Among the complications that are eliminated is that of having to convert the files, which will be done while the files are being transferred to your device. On the other hand, your iDevice does not have to be jailbroken.
The system couldn't be simpler: we will only have to drag our files to the WALTR window to start the transfer process. WALTR has been around for a long time on OS X, but its increasing success has finally made it to Windows, too.
The good thing about the WALTR version for Windows is that it has a more careful design than the Mac version. As we said before, it combines an uploader (to upload) and a converter in the same application, so that Any multimedia file that is dropped in the WALTR window will be uploaded to your iOS device in a format that will be compatible with it.. Also, another point in its favor is that we will not need any third-party application to play the files, since are transferred to the Videos and Music application from your iPhone / iPod or iPad. Softorino, the WALTR development team, says that are working on adding subtitle support, which will be perfect for those who occasionally want to see a movie in VOS The Mac version already has this function, so it shouldn't take long to get to Windows.
But something so good cannot be true. In this case, it is, but it loses a lot if we look at its price. Like any quality application, WALTR is an expensive application, it is said and nothing happens. With a price of $ 29.95 In its cheapest version, it may be better to learn how to use iTunes with your music list and a third-party video application to be able to enjoy your multimedia content. But if, knowing everything, you are still interested in acquiring WALTR, you have it available at http://softorino.com/waltr. There's a 14-day trial period, enough to know if the application interests you or not. WALTR is a very good application and, if you don't go to iTunes, maybe it will be worth it. I have paid more for applications that I no longer use. It all depends on the needs of each user.
